| Definition of 'themis' |
Princeton's WordNet |
|
1. (noun) Themis
(Greek mythology) the Titaness who was goddess of justice in ancient mythology

| Definitions of 'themis' |
The Nuttall Encyclopedia |
|
1. themis
in the Greek mythology the goddess of the established order of things; was a daughter of Uranos and Gaia, and the spouse of Zeus, through whom she became the mother of the divinities concerned in maintaining order among, at once, gods and men.
